インターフェース KafkaListenerContainerFactory<C extends MessageListenerContainer>

型パラメーター:
C - MessageListenerContainer 実装型。
すべての既知の実装クラス:
AbstractKafkaListenerContainerFactoryConcurrentKafkaListenerContainerFactory

public interface KafkaListenerContainerFactory<C extends MessageListenerContainer>
MessageListenerContainer のファクトリ。
作成者:
Stephane Nicoll, Gary Russell
関連事項:
  • メソッドのサマリー

    修飾子と型
    メソッド
    説明
    リスナーなしでコンテナーを作成して構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。
    リスナーなしでコンテナーを作成して構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。
    リスナーなしでコンテナーを作成して構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。
    指定された KafkaListenerEndpointMessageListenerContainer を作成します。
  • メソッドの詳細

    • createListenerContainer

      C createListenerContainer(KafkaListenerEndpoint endpoint)
      指定された KafkaListenerEndpointMessageListenerContainer を作成します。このメソッドを使用して作成されたコンテナーは、リスナーエンドポイントレジストリに追加されます。
      パラメーター:
      endpoint - 構成するエンドポイント
      戻り値:
      作成されたコンテナー
    • createContainer

      C createContainer(TopicPartitionOffset... topicPartitions)
      リスナーなしでコンテナーを作成および構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。この方法を使用して作成されたコンテナーは、リスナーエンドポイントレジストリに追加されません。
      パラメーター:
      topicPartitions - 割り当てる topicPartitions。
      戻り値:
      コンテナー。
      導入:
      2.3
    • createContainer

      C createContainer(StringSE... topics)
      リスナーなしでコンテナーを作成および構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。この方法を使用して作成されたコンテナーは、リスナーエンドポイントレジストリに追加されません。
      パラメーター:
      topics - トピック。
      戻り値:
      コンテナー。
      導入:
      2.2
    • createContainer

      C createContainer(PatternSE topicPattern)
      リスナーなしでコンテナーを作成および構成します。KafkaListener アノテーションに使用されないコンテナーを作成するために使用されます。この方法を使用して作成されたコンテナーは、リスナーエンドポイントレジストリに追加されません。
      パラメーター:
      topicPattern - topicPattern。
      戻り値:
      コンテナー。
      導入:
      2.2